The actuator might be at fault here.
While all the stuff online focuses on VE with dual or single zone, the operation of the trizone is an extention of the dual zone HVAC. There is additional doors operated by the same types of actuators.

Just took the WM to the workshop.

Took the passenger side covers off of the console and found the actuator for the rear feet, see picture. Did a HVAC reset and noticed that all actuators were moving ok. So I tested where the air came out based on face, feet or both. Turns out that the rear feet only delivers air when you choose the feet only option.

So I swapped out the existing actuator for a brand new one. Did HVAC reset and tested where the air came out. Same as the original. So I swapped the original back in (no point using up a new one...).

Did some further tests and found out that air only comes out of the rear feet vents if you select feet only (feet and face won't work). I also checked with the zones; air comes out if you select single, dual or tri zone.

So if you have a WM, chances are it's working as per design, you just need to select feet only... It means that rear passengers can't get feet and face at the same time.
